Responsibilities

  • Lead a multidisciplinary team of 10+ researchers in developing quantum algorithms for commercial applications
  • Design and implement error-correction protocols for next-generation quantum processors
  • Partner with hardware teams to optimize quantum software for proprietary computing architectures
  • Secure $5M+ annual research funding through government grants and industry partnerships
  • Develop patentable quantum solutions addressing real-world enterprise challenges
  • Mentor junior researchers and publish findings in top-tier scientific journals
  • Represent FutureTech at global quantum computing forums and industry summits

Qualifications

  • PhD in Quantum Physics, Computer Science, or related field with 8+ years industry experience
  • Proven track record of publishing in Nature/Science or equivalent peer-reviewed journals
  • Expertise in quantum programming languages (Q#, Qiskit, Cirq) and simulation frameworks
  • Experience managing research teams with $2M+ annual budgets
  • Demonstrated success in translating theoretical concepts into commercial prototypes
  • Strong background in cryptography, machine learning, or materials science
  • Excellent presentation skills and ability to communicate complex concepts to technical/non-technical stakeholders
